推荐文章:Flutter Lottie - 动画交互的轻量级桥梁

推荐文章:Flutter Lottie - 动画交互的轻量级桥梁

flutter_lottieUse lottie in flutter for both iOS and Android项目地址:https://gitcode.com/gh_mirrors/fl/flutter_lottie


在数字产品设计的世界里,动画不再仅仅是视觉上的点缀,而是用户体验不可或缺的一部分。今天,我们要向您隆重推荐一个开源神器——flutter_lottie,这是一座连接Flutter世界与动态动画设计的坚实桥梁。

1、项目介绍

flutter_lottie 让您能够在Flutter应用程序中无缝集成Lottie动画。Lottie是由Airbnb推出的革命性工具,它允许设计师通过Adobe After Effects创作动画,并以JSON格式导出,进而被前端和移动应用直接使用。而flutter_lottie正是这一过程中的关键环节,它实现了对iOS和Android双平台的支持,借助[lottie-ios]和[lottie-android]的强大底层,让您的Flutter应用焕发生机,轻松嵌入精美动画。

2、项目技术分析

flutter_lottie的设计巧妙地利用了Flutter的跨平台特性和Lottie的轻量级数据驱动模式。它支持大部分由原生Lottie库提供的特性,确保了高度的兼容性与一致性。目前,动态属性更改仅限于颜色和不透明度的调整,但这足以覆盖许多常见需求。开发团队承诺后续更新将扩展更多动态属性的支持,这意味着开发者将拥有更大的灵活性来创造互动体验。

3、项目及技术应用场景

想象一下,在欢迎页面上,一个优雅的加载动画代替了冰冷的加载圈;或者在功能教程中,简明扼要的动画引导用户轻松掌握操作要领。从APP启动图标到内部的微交互,flutter_lottie都是提升应用趣味性和用户体验的理想选择。特别是在教育软件、社交媒体应用以及游戏界面中,生动的动画能显著增强用户的沉浸感和满意度。

4、项目特点

  • 跨平台兼容:无论是iOS还是Android,一次集成,两端受益。
  • 轻量高效:基于JSON的动画数据让资源体积小巧,加载快速。
  • 设计与开发解耦:设计师的创意无需编码即可实现,加速开发流程。
  • 逐步增强的动态性:当前支持的颜色和不透明度动态调整,未来将提供更广泛的自定义空间。
  • 易用性:示例详尽,即便是Flutter初学者也能迅速上手。

综上所述,flutter_lottie是那些寻求以最小成本为应用增添生动与个性化的开发者的不二之选。通过它,不仅能够让您的应用在众多同类产品中脱颖而出,还能极大提升用户的情感联系和使用体验。现在就加入flutter_lottie的使用者行列,解锁应用动画的新天地吧!

# 开启你的动画之旅
与flutter_lottie一起,探索无限可能的交互设计世界!

通过简单的引入与配置,就能让你的Flutter应用绽放出不一样的光彩,何乐而不为呢?立即行动起来,让flutter_lottie成为你下一个项目中不可或缺的一员吧!

flutter_lottieUse lottie in flutter for both iOS and Android项目地址:https://gitcode.com/gh_mirrors/fl/flutter_lottie

  • 5
    点赞
  • 10
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

尤琦珺Bess

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值